How to say nobody can exist without food. in Japanese

1)誰も誰も(daremo) (conj) everyone/anyone/no-one食事食事(shokuji) (n) meal/to eatなしでなしで(nashide) (exp) withoutは(ha) (int) indicating a subject/yes/indeed/well/ha!/what?/huh?/sigh生き生き(iki) (n) living/being alive/freshness/liveliness/vitality/situation in which a group of stones cannot be captured because it contains contains two or more gaps/stet/leave as-is/damnedられno dictionary result, likely a conjigated verbno dictionary result, likely a conjigated verbないない(nai) (aux-adj) not/emphatic suffix。(。) Japanese period "."    
daremo shokuji nashideha iki rarenai 。
